AsCuO2S is a mixed-valent copper arsenic oxide sulfide ceramic compound containing arsenic, copper, oxygen, and sulfur elements. This is a research-phase material studied primarily in solid-state chemistry and materials science contexts, rather than an established commercial engineering ceramic. Potential applications lie in semiconducting or photocatalytic systems where the combination of arsenic, copper, and sulfide chemistry might enable photovoltaic effects, catalytic activity, or electronic properties; however, arsenic-containing ceramics face regulatory and toxicity constraints that limit industrial adoption compared to lead-free or less-toxic alternatives.
